Detroit's Electronic Music Festival: Mark your calendars, book your flights / hotels and tell your friends about one of the best weekends of electronic music events in the known universe. Saturday May 26 through Sunday May 28, noon-midnight in beautiful Hart Plaza, downtown Detroit - on the riverfront. And that’s just the festival itself. With over 50 afterparties held throughout the weekend last year you no doubt will hear some of your favorite artists play, somewhere. The word on official afterparties as well as all other relevant info to help you have the best time you can in Detroit will be on the festival website (www.demf.com) as soon as it becomes available.

As for the festival itself: Movement 07 will feature performances by legendary Detroit artists Moodymann live featuring Pitch Black City; Model 500 featuring the godfather of Detroit Techno Juan Atkins; and Jeff Mills, the longtime hard hitting "wizard" of Detroit Techno.

Moodymann (Kenny Dixon Jr.) is a legendary Detroit techno/house artist known for his innovative use of reworked riffs, samples and grooves taken from the City's historically influential jazz, soul, funk and disco scene. Rarely appearing live, his headlining performance at the festival is the first show in support of his upcoming studio album and will include a full stage show with a band.

Juan Atkins, who is widely regarded as the godfather of Techno, began in the 1980s recording what stands as perhaps the most influential body of work within the genre. Model 500 will headline the main stage on Sunday at the festival, highlighting the continuing influence of his music on a global scale.

Jeff Mills is a planetary superstar of techno, an unwearied hero of mega-events and an ace of the three-deck mix; his musical touch has been a force on this city's dance scene for over 20 years. Jeff returns to Detroit to headline the festival with a main stage closing performance on Monday night.

Other 2007 special performances include German producers Booka Shade, who have earned a reputation as one of the world's most exciting live electronic music acts. Their performance at the 2007 festival will mark Booka Shade's first appearance in Detroit. Also performing live will be Octave One, featuring Detroit natives, brothers Lenny and Lawrence Burden, who have released groundbreaking underground dance anthems on their Detroit-based record label, 430 West Records.
